Section 01

Neighborhood Overview

Emery Secondary School is situated in Emeryville, a compact city nestled between Oakland and Berkeley along the eastern shores of the San Francisco Bay. Its prime location offers convenient access to major transit arteries, including Interstate 80 and the Bay Bridge, connecting it directly to San Francisco. The school is easily accessible by car, with primary access points on 47th Street and Peladeau Drive. Parking availability can vary, especially on event days, so arriving early is often recommended. For those relying on public transportation, AC Transit bus lines serve the immediate vicinity, providing routes to Oakland, Berkeley, and beyond. The nearest major transit hub is the MacArthur BART station, located a short drive or bus ride away, offering broader regional connectivity. Rideshare services are also readily available throughout Emeryville and the greater East Bay. Navigating to the school typically involves surface streets once off the interstate, with traffic often peaking during traditional morning and afternoon commute hours. Consider planning your arrival to avoid these busy periods if possible, particularly if attending a scheduled event.

Section 08

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Emeryville brings cool temperatures, with daytime highs often in the 50s and nighttime lows dipping into the 40s. Expect frequent rain showers, making waterproof jackets, umbrellas, and sturdy footwear a must for attending outdoor events. Indoor activities or venues with good shelter are highly recommended during this season. Dressing in layers is advisable to adapt to temperature changes throughout the day.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ring and early summer offer increasingly pleasant weather, with temperatures gradually warming into the 60s and 70s. Mornings can still be cool and foggy, particularly near the bay, but afternoons are typically mild and sunny. A light jacket or sweater is usually sufficient for cooler periods, while shorts and t-shirts become comfortable for warmer days. It's an excellent time for outdoor sports and exploration before the peak summer heat.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er, from July through September, is generally the warmest period, with daytime temperatures often in the 70s and occasionally reaching the 80s. However, the proximity to the bay usually provides a cooling breeze, preventing extreme heat. Light, breathable clothing is ideal, but a light layer might still be useful for cooler evenings or foggy mornings. Sunscreen and hats are recommended for extended periods outdoors.

🍂

Fall season

The fall season brings a return to cooler temperatures, with highs typically in the 60s and lows in the 50s. The weather remains generally pleasant for outdoor activities, though occasional rain can begin in late fall. Layers are key, as the transition from warm afternoons to cooler evenings is noticeable. This season is often favored for its comfortable climate and fewer crowds compared to the summer months.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is the primary weather concern in Emeryville, particularly from late fall through early spring. Snow is extremely rare and practically unheard of in this coastal region. Visitors should always check the forecast before traveling and pack accordingly, ensuring they have waterproof gear for any outdoor activities or travel. Indoor options are plentiful, serving as good alternatives during persistent rainy spells.
